Note 13 – Leases

Lessor

Equipment on operating leases is reported net of accumulated depreciation of $33.6 million and $33.4 million as of February 28, 2021 and August 31, 2020, respectively. Depreciation expense was $3.2 million and $6.8 million for the three and six months ended February 28, 2021, respectively and $3.0 million and $6.6 million for the three and six months ended February 29, 2020, respectively. In addition, certain railcar equipment leased-in by the Company on operating leases is subleased to customers under non-cancelable operating leases with lease terms ranging from one to fifteen years. Operating lease rental revenues included in the Company’s Statements of Operations for the three and six months ended February 28, 2021 was $12.3 million and $24.1 million, respectively, which included $3.8 million and $7.4 million, respectively, of revenue as a result of daily, monthly or car hire utilization arrangements. Operating lease rental revenues included in the Company’s Statements of Operations for the three and six months ended February 29, 2020 was $9.8 million and $21.2 million, respectively, which included $2.8 million and $6.5 million, respectively, of revenue as a result of daily, monthly or car hire utilization arrangements.

Lessee

The Company leases railcars, real estate, and certain equipment under operating and, to a lesser extent, finance lease arrangements. As of and for the three and six months ended February 28, 2021 and February 29, 2020, finance leases were not a material component of the Company's lease portfolio. The Company’s real estate and equipment leases have remaining lease terms ranging from less than one year to 77 years, with some including options to extend up to 15 years. The Company recognizes a lease liability and corresponding right-of-use (ROU) asset based on the present value of lease payments. To determine the present value of lease payments, as most of its leases do not provide a readily determinable implicit rate, the Company’s incremental borrowing rate is used to discount the lease payments based on information available at lease commencement date. The Company gives consideration to its recent debt issuances as well as publicly available data for instruments with similar characteristics when estimating its incremental borrowing rate.
